Publisher's description
From InternetSafety :Safe Eyes 2005 parental-control software provides all of the protection needed against undesirable material on the Internet. Using SafeBrowse.com's content-filtering technology allows you to ban access to certain types of Web sites. The integrated pop-up blocker automatically closes annoying ads that appear when you visit Web sites. In this version you now can monitor all of the Web sites a user visits, and logs can be reviewed anytime through a Web-based portal. Safe Eyes 2005 also contains time controls to help you control time spent online. Best of all, Safe Eyes 2005 is the only Internet control software that will call you on the telephone when access to undesirable material is detected.
